Planning application

Jack Straws Castle 12 North End Way London NW3 7ES

Withdrawn Camden 2019/0730/P Full applications

Withdrawn before a decision, so it carries no planning weight. A revised scheme can be submitted at any time.

Proposal

Change of use of basement and ground floor levels from Class D2 (health club) to flexible use of D1 (education), Class D2 (leisure) or Class B1 (office)

As published by the council, reference 2019/0730/P

What withdrawal means

The applicant withdrew this application before Camden decided it, and is free to submit a revised scheme at any time.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About full applications

A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
